> Travis currently uses ASAN for leak detection.
> This tool does identify leaks, but it only tracks the initial allocation of 
> the object from the heap.
> This trace information can be inaccurate for objects stored in alloc pools, 
> since it does not account for when objects are returned by to the pool.
> By enabling the built-in alloc_pool leak checker as well we'll get more 
> accurate traces that identify the last owner of the leaked object.
